Здраствуйте, подскажите как правильно работать со временем? (складывать, вычитать).
А то написал код, который высчитывает оставшееся время до наступления события. Работает не правильно...
Код:
var t:TTime;
begin
t:=StrToTime(18:00:00);
Label1.Caption:=TimeToStr(Time-t);
end;
Вобщем считает правильно, когда t<Time... А когда t>Time, то считает уже не правильно, значение начинает увеличиваться(подозреваю до 00:00:00)...
Как мне с этим бороться?